Chinabank was again lauded by the CFA Society Philippines for delivering the best returns to investors. For the eighth year, Chinabank Dollar Fixed Income Fund, formerly called Chinabank Dollar Fund, was named as the Best Managed Fund of the Year in the Dollar Long-Term Bond (FVPL category) at the 2024 Best Managed Fund Awards on April 24 at The City Club Alphaland in Makati.
The CFA Society Philippines recognizes high performing funds that are available to the public to raise awareness among retail investors and promote investor education and excellence in the industry. This year, only 13, including Chinabank Dollar Fixed Income Fund, were distinguished as the best managed funds out of the 136 qualified funds from 17 investment houses and trust institutions evaluated.
“We’re focused on helping our clients achieve their investment objectives, expertly managing all our funds to maximize returns at the least possible volatility,” Chinabank Trust Officer Mary Ann Lim said, noting that including this latest award, the bank has garnered a total of 11 Best Managed Fund awards since the CFA Society Philippines launched the program in 2016.
Best suited for investors with a moderate risk appetite and a long-term investment horizon, the award-winning Chinabank Dollar Fixed Income Fund is invested in a diversified portfolio of high-grade marketable securities comprised mainly of Philippine sovereign bonds and US treasury bonds of varying tenors with an average duration of not more than ten years. It aims to outperform its benchmark, the Bloomberg EM USD Sovereign-Philippine Total Return Index.
